In … Webnovel Lord of the Flies by William Golding, the conch shell is a central symbol of mankind’s struggle to build a civilization that is necessary for the survival of a group of young boys stranded in an unknown world. The conch shell plays various roles, symbolizes important concepts, and produces many effects that impact their lives.

Web6 jun. 2024 · Thursday 6 June 1974. Twenty years after writing Lord Of The Flies, I now see that Ralph who weeps for the end of innocence, the darkness of man’s heart, was weeping for an age that is passing. Seen from the other side, the heart of man is not dark, but flamelit and terrible.
